Output 18750de75f5bde8b6853b33238c9341e2eeeb13bbbb76a2d83c10e141a3fc013:2

value
22611923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bee96f6c715ca99d5e5b88f334aebc890a4a357 OP_EQUAL
address
MHjrMTb7Rhr2MY512SWGLtzhrXHUYXXNfY
transaction
18750de75f5bde8b6853b33238c9341e2eeeb13bbbb76a2d83c10e141a3fc013
spent
true